These gauntlets were really cool once I finished them, but they were so challenging to make. I mean, wide diagonal stripes in the round? Who does that? Cartoon Network obviously designs their characters’ wardrobes to be as hard to recreate as possible in order to have a monopoly on merchandise. After conquering the diagonal stripes (plus figuring out a thumb gusset), one has to knit the fingers in red and switch to black on the tips. That alone creates so many ends. THEN the little pink gems along the knuckles have to be improvised- they must be pointy enough to actually look like stones or else the whole thing looks like a cow’s udder. Lastly, a star must be knit and sewed onto the whole thing. Then the second one has to be done.
